Stephen Tao in Richmond, California
In our database, we have found 1 person named Stephen Tao in Richmond, CA, along with this person's date of birth, home address, phone numbers, email addresses, workplace, social profiles, and more.
Stephen W Tao
23 Lakeshore Ct, Richmond, CA, 94804
Current
FAQ about Stephen Tao
Stephen Tao currently lives at 23 Lakeshore Ct, Richmond, California, 94804 and has lived at this address since 2020.
Stephen Tao is also known as: Stephanos Tao, Stepan Tao, Estebe Tao. These names can be aliases, nicknames, or other names he has used.